Что такое cURL?
cURL, акроним для “Client URL”, это открытый командный утилита, предназначенная для передачи и получения данных через синтаксис URL. Он является мощным инструментом для автоматизации и, безусловно, лучшим командным интерфейсом с надежной поддержкой прокси. Проект программного обеспечения включает в себя библиотеку (libcurl) и командную утилиту (curl), причем наша основная задача — последнее, инструмент, созданный для передачи данных через синтаксис URL.
cURL поддерживает обширный набор протоколов, включая, но не ограничиваясь, HTTP, HTTPS, FTP, FTPS, SFTP, POP3, IMAP, IMAPS, LDAP, LDAPS и SCP, что делает его наиболее широко используемым и предпочтительным командным HTTP-клиентом.Многофункциональность cURL делает его универсальным решением для множества задач, таких как выполнение HTTP-запросов, загрузка данных, загрузка файлов и взаимодействие с API. Он предлагает ряд функций, варьирующихся от настройки запросов до поддержки прокси.Чтобы лучше понять его, давайте рассмотрим самый простой пример использования cURL.Откройте терминал или командную строку, введите curl https://www.google.com в эту команду и нажмите Enter. Это получит HTML страницы и напечатает его в консоли.
Базовые команды cURL
После установки cURL вы можете начать его использовать:Получить веб-страницу: просто используйте «curl https://www.example.com» для получения HTML-содержимого веб-страницы.Скачать файл: нужно получить файл? Используйте «curl -o https://www.example.com/file.zip» для его загрузки на ваш компьютер.
Отправить данные: Вы даже можете использовать Curl для отправки данных с помощью POST-запроса. Например, ‘curl -d “username=User&password=Pass” https://www.example.com/login' отправит информацию для входа.Использование заголовков: если вам нужно добавить заголовки к вашему запросу, просто включите их с помощью опции -H: ‘curl -h’ authorization: держатель вашего “https://www.example.com/api".
Сохранить вывод: хотите сохранить результаты команды curl в файл? Используйте «curl https://www.example.com -o output.html».
Зачем использовать cURL Proxies?
Использование прокси в сочетании с cURL представляет собой эффективный метод обхода ограничений сети и сохранения анонимности во время передачи данных. С его способностью принимать различные формы прокси и его гибкостью в управлении аутентификацией прокси и исключениями, cURL предоставляет полный набор инструментов для управления прокси.Будь вы программистом, столкнувшимся с ограничениями сети, или пользователем, заботящимся о цифровой конфиденциальности, приобретение навыков работы с cURL proxy может быть бесценным активом. Вооружившись этими знаниями, вы можете перемещаться по цифровому ландшафту с улучшенной безопасностью, получать доступ к ограниченным ресурсам и поддерживать свою анонимность в киберпространстве.
Узнать больше: https://www.okeyproxy.com/en/residential-proxies